Antimicrobial Susceptibility Pattern of E.coli isolated from urinary tract infections at Al-Quwayiyah General Hospital, Al- Quwayiyah, Kingdom of Saudi Arabia

Abstract

Urinary tract infection (UTI) is the most common among all hospital acquired infections worldwide. In UTI, most common organism is E.coli. Organism responsible for the hospital acquired infection may have tendency to develop multiple drug resistance. E.coli acquired from the Al-Quwayiyah General Hospital source may differ in their resistant against antibiotics. This was a retrospective study conducted in an Al-Quwayiyah General hospital to know the prevalence and antibiogram of E.coli. Samples received include mid-stream clean catch urine, suprapubic aspirate and from Foley’s catheter. All the plates were inspected for growth and the isolates were identified by observing colony morphology, Gram-stain characteristics and relevant biochemical tests. The isolates were tested for their antimicrobial susceptibility and the results were interpreted by vitek 2 methods, according to the guidelines of Clinical and Laboratory Standards Institute. Out of 96 samples tested, 53 (55.2%) were positive for E.coli. E.coli was highly resistant to Ampicillin (85.1%) followed by Piperacillin (66.03%) and least resistance was seen with Nalidixic acid (5.6%) and Nitrofurantoin (5.6%) followed by and Ciprofloxacin (11.3%). Knowledge of prevalence and antimicrobial susceptibility pattern of E. coli will help in selecting an appropriate antibiotic for empirical therapy. Formulation of hospital infection control committee and strict adherence to the guidelines of the committee will help in preventing the emergence of drug resistance.
